#d1cdea h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d1cdea is composed of 82% red, 80.4%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.7% cyan, 12.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 248.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.8% and a lightness of 86.1%. #d1cdea color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a39bd5.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

● #d1cdea color description : Light grayish blue.
The hexadecimal color #d1cdea has RGB values of R:209, G:205,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 13749738.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030205 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fb is the lightest one.
